The Power of One-on-One Attention
Think of private lessons as having a personal trainer for your musical fitness. Your instructor can immediately spot and correct technical issues, breathing problems, or embouchure challenges that might go unnoticed in a crowded classroom. This immediate feedback loop accelerates your progress and prevents the formation of bad habits that can take months to unlearn.
Customized Learning Pace and Progression
Every musician learns differently, and private clarinet lessons honor this fundamental truth. Some students grasp fingering patterns quickly but struggle with rhythm, while others excel at sight-reading but need extra work on tone production. Private instruction allows you to spend more time on challenging concepts without holding back other students or feeling rushed to keep up with faster learners.

Addressing Individual Challenges
Every clarinetist faces unique physical and technical challenges. Perhaps you have smaller hands that make certain fingerings difficult, or maybe you struggle with breath control due to lung capacity. Private lessons allow for personalized solutions and alternative techniques that group classes simply cannot accommodate.

Embouchure and Tone Quality Focus
Developing a proper embouchure is crucial for clarinet success, and this delicate process requires individual attention. In private lessons, your teacher can guide you through the subtle adjustments needed to achieve a rich, focused tone that group instruction often cannot adequately address.
Advanced Technique Mastery
Complex techniques like altissimo register playing, advanced articulation patterns, and extended techniques require detailed instruction that’s difficult to provide in group settings. Private lessons offer the time and attention necessary to master these challenging aspects of clarinet performance.
